## Break-Glass Access: Reset Flow Revamp

Heads up, reviewers: while the Lockstep password reset revamp ships, break-glass access to the old flow stays live for rollback. It's gated behind the Quillgate vault and audited end to end. If you need to pop it open during review, the unlock passphrase is below.

recovery phrase for fahap-haduf: casvan-eliius-novmir-holiel-oliwyn-brivan-gilax-gilael-gilax-wenius-rusael-istius-ralys-julwyn

**Handover note — nightly search reindex (Querrelle)**

Handing the Querrelle reindex job to support coverage. It runs nightly; if it stalls past two hours, kill the worker and restart from the last checkpoint — partial indexes are safe to serve. Alerts route to the search channel. To unlock the reindex admin console during an incident, use the recovery passphrase below.

unlock words, kagef-taduf: fenir-quenix-norwyn-sorvan-gormir-gorir-fraok

## Build agents drifting out of sync (clock skew)

If Hatchline builds fail with "artifact signed in the future," you've hit clock skew between agents. It happens when the Pellworth rack reboots and NTP takes a while to settle. Quick fix: drain the agent, run the time-sync job, re-enroll it. Don't just retry the build — signatures will keep failing. Check skew with the agent-status endpoint; anything over 30 seconds is bad. The status endpoint authenticates with the token below.

login token, bagug-kafop: eyJhbGciOiJIUzI1NiIsInR5cCI6IkpXVCJ9.eyJzdWIiOiIcMLov2In0.Z5RLDIfp

Fan-out backpressure for the Quillet notifier: when the queue depth crosses the soft limit, the dispatcher sheds low-priority pushes and batches the rest at 500ms intervals. Reviewer should confirm the shed counter is exported and that retries respect the jitter window. Once merged, the release artifact gets re-signed by the pipeline, which expects the deploy key shown below.

deploy key for bawep-yawif: bky6_GQhaSt